This new EECOM sub-committee is dedicated to promoting environmental education in teacher education programs across Canada. We met for the first time on 29th May 2017. Earth Rangers is the kids’ conservation organization, dedicated to educating children and their families about biodiversity, inspiring them to adopt sustainable behaviours, and empowering them to become directly involved in protecting animals and their habitats. Acadia University in Wolfville, Nova Scotia recently had the pleasure of hosting over 330 environmental educators from across Canada during the 2017 Canadian Network for Environmental Education and Communication (EECOM) conference. EECOM presented our 2017 Awards of Excellence in Wolfville, Nova Scotia on May 20.
